Learning outcomes

The student is able to
- identify and develop their interaction skills
- encounter and interact with individuals
- work in and manage groups
- highlight the significance of client participation and resources

Completion alternatives

Students are entitled for accreditation of this course by demonstrating their competence in professional dialogue in social care practice.

The assessment is carried out according to the same criteria and grading scale as that adopted for the corresponding study unit.

Student workload

Allocated Study time for the 5 cr (1 cr ~ 27h) course:

Videoanalysis assignment 2 cr
Reflective Diary essay 2 cr
Participation to contact meetings 1 cr

Further information

In order to achieve the competences of this course personal and active attendance in contact lessons is required. Students are expected to attend 70% of the contact lessons (4 of 6 sessions).

According to the degree regulations (section 18) “students must be present in the first contact session or notify their teacher in charge if they cannot attend. If they fail to notify the teacher of their absence in the first contact session, their enrolment will be rejected. Another student in the queue may be enrolled in the study unit in the place of the absent student.”
